摘要

Plant disease detection is a critical agricultural management aspect affecting crop yields and food security. Plant diseases significantly threaten global agriculture, leading to substantial economic losses and food security concerns. For efficient disease control and crop protection, plant diseases must be promptly identified and monitored. The novel application of genetic algorithms and image segmentation methods to plant disease detection is the subject of this study. Genetic algorithms, which draw inspiration from natural selection, have demonstrated potential for improving feature selection and parameter tuning, among other elements of illness detection systems. On the other hand, early intervention is made possible by the accurate identification of disease-affected areas in plant through the use of image segmentation. The survey explores integrating these methods for plant disease detection, addressing challenges like environmental factors and data quality. This review is a valuable resource for researchers, practitioners, and policymakers in agriculture for effective plant disease management.
